What are JWCH and what do they do?

JWCH Institute, Inc. is a non-profit health organization that provides health care and social services to underserved populations, particularly in Los Angeles, California. Their services include primary medical care, HIV prevention and treatment, homeless health care, behavioral health services, and substance use treatment. JWCH aims to improve community health through accessible, comprehensive, and culturally sensitive care, often targeting people experiencing homelessness and those with limited access to medical resources.

Job description

Position Description:The Psychiatry Medical Assistant (Behavioral Health Support) reports to the Psychiatric Specialist Supervisor for administrative oversight and to the Chief of Psychiatry, or designee, for clinical supervision. This role provides clinical and administrative support to Behavioral Health and Psychiatric providers, including Psychiatrists and Psychiatric Nurse Practitioners. Responsibilities include coordinating patient care, managing provider schedules, supporting psychiatric workflows, and assisting with patient care within the Medical Assistant scope of practice. As a Psychiatric Medical Assistant at JWCH, you will have the opportunity to grow your career while helping to improve the lives and health status of the undersereved segments of the population of the greater Los Angeles area.

Principal Responsibilities:

  • Prepare patients for psychiatric visits, including required screenings, consents, and documentation.
  • Room patients and obtain vital signs in accordance with scope of practice.
  • Administer and document standardized behavioral health screening tools (e.g., PHQ-9, GAD-7) per protocol.
  • Support medication management workflows, including refill requests, prior authorizations, and pharmacy coordination.
  • Document patient information accurately in the electronic medical record (NextGen).
  • Assist with telehealth visit setup and patient readiness.
  • Maintain stocked, organized, and prepared clinical areas. Behavioral Health Coordination.
  • Manage appointments and scheduling for Behavioral Health and Psychiatric providers.
  • Conduct triage and assess urgency of referrals, supporting crisis intervention workflows as needed.
  • Provide warm hand-offs between administrative and clinical teams to ensure continuity of care.
  • Oversee provider panels and optimize scheduling, including waitlist management.
  • Follow up on no-shows and reschedule patients promptly; document all outreach attempts.
  • Process and coordinate behavioral health referrals within the EMR system.Front Office & Administrative Support
  • Perform patient registration, check-in, and check-out processes.
  • Verify insurance, payer selection, and sliding fee scale eligibility.
  • Conduct pre-visit planning and pre-check-in 24 hours prior to appointments.
  • Respond to patient calls and messages regarding appointments, medication requests, and urgent needs.
  • Assist with medical records requests and care coordination.
  • Run reports and support administrative tracking as needed.
  • Utilize the AIDET (Acknowledge, Introduce, Duration, Explanation, Thank You) communication framework.
  • Provide culturally competent,trauma-informed care to a diverse patient population.
  • Educate patients on visit expectations, follow-up care, and available services.
  • Promote a welcoming, respectful, and supportive clinic environment.
  • Adhere to all organizational policies, safety standards, and regulatory requirements.
  • Maintain infection control and workplace safety practices.
  • Participate in required training, meetings, and quality improvement initiatives.
  • Collaborate with medical, dental, and behavioral health teams to improve patient flow and reduce waiting times.
  • Perform other duties as assigned within scope of practice.


Requirements:

  • Completion of an accreditedโ€ฏMedical Assistant programโ€ฏrequired.
  • Active Medical Assistant certificationโ€ฏ(CMA, RMA, or equivalent)required
  • Minimumโ€ฏ2 years of experience in behavioral health or psychiatric setting.
  • At leastโ€ฏ1 year of clinical Medical Assistant experienceโ€ฏ(vitals, patient care, documentation).
  • Experience supporting Psychiatrists or Psychiatric Nurse Practitioners preferred.
  • Strong understanding of behavioral health workflows and patient populations.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Ability to multitask and work effectively in a fast-paced environment.
  • Proficiency with electronic medical records (NextGen preferred) and Microsoft Office.
  • Knowledge of scheduling, referrals, and insurance processes.
  • Bilingual (English/Spanish) preferred.

Employee Benefits

JWCH Institute, Inc., offers competitive salaries for all positions. Employees working 30 hours per week or more are provided a monthly allowance which can be used towards medical, dental, vision, and life insurance premiums. The agency offers sick leave and vacation accrual, 13 paid holidays, jury duty pay, mileage reimbursement, employee parking, direct deposit, credit union, and an employee assistance program. In addition JWCH offers a 401(k) Profit Sharing plan to employees who work a minimum of 1,000 hours per fiscal year.
